Our Summit County Waste Management Authority has recently started a "Get Caught Green Handed" campaign, where they put a small green hand sign in your yard if you fill up your recycling bin. A small incentive for a very wothwhile project. They also now have a program where you can take all of your old computers, and electronics to recycle for free. They will re-use what they can, and part out the rest for return to manufacturers and re-manufacturers. No parts are ever burned, or sent to third world countries.
